Transaction 953848e481635a1c8b80eccb448d426cdbd75edc3f5d160c7f1d2bd75f37c121

5 Input
2 Outputs
  • 953848e481635a1c8b80eccb448d426cdbd75edc3f5d160c7f1d2bd75f37c121:0
  • value  6986228
    address  3BVCuMSKFt87QeFZFS8Pc2h32niYZFQtgP
  • 953848e481635a1c8b80eccb448d426cdbd75edc3f5d160c7f1d2bd75f37c121:1
  • value  1750135
    address  35mXGRz2VFQ2hxD9NJa1QV7nKqzpZXimfc